Custom Cabinets Add Long-Term Value
Unlike stock cabinets that come in predetermined sizes, custom cabinetry is built specifically for your home. Every cabinet is designed to maximize available space while complementing your home’s architecture and your personal style.
Some of the long-term benefits include:
- Better use of every inch of available space.
- Higher-quality craftsmanship and materials.
- Personalized storage solutions.
- Timeless designs that remain attractive for years.
- Increased appeal for future homebuyers.
Create a Kitchen That Reflects Your Style
Your kitchen should feel like an extension of your personality, not a copy of a showroom display. One of the greatest advantages of choosing handcrafted custom cabinetry is the ability to personalize nearly every detail.
Popular customization options include:
- Classic shaker cabinets.
- Modern slab cabinet doors.
- Natural wood finishes.
- Painted cabinetry in timeless neutral tones.
- Decorative glass cabinet inserts.
- Built-in pantry storage.
- Custom islands with additional seating.
- Hidden storage features that reduce countertop clutter.
These personalized details help create a kitchen that’s both beautiful and highly functional for everyday living.
